Opis ogólny

Sodium/potassium-transporting ATPase subunit alpha-2 (EC 3.6.3.9; UniProt P06686; also known as Na+/K+ -ATPase alpha 2 subunit, Na(+)/K(+) ATPase alpha(+) subunit, Sodium pump subunit alpha-2) is encoded by the Atp1a2 (also known as RATATPA2) gene (Gene ID 24212) in rat. Mammalian Na+/K+ ATPase is a heteromultimeric complex composed of alpha, beta, and gamma subunits. The alpha subunit catalyzes the hydrolysis of ATP coupled with the exchange of Na+ and K+ across the plasma membrane. The alpha subunit contains ten transmembrane domains with both its N- and C-termini in the cytoplasm. More than 50 mutations have been identified affecting the human ATP1A2 and ATP1A3 genes that are known to cause rapid-onset Dystonia Parkinsonism, familial hemiplegic migraine, alternating hemiplegia of childhood, and variants of familial hemiplegic migraine with neurological complications including seizures and various mood disorders.

Specyficzność

Reacts with Sodium Pump (Na+ pump (Na+-K+-ATPase)) alpha 2 isoform. The antibody does not cross react with other Na+-K+-ATPase alpha isoforms.

Immunogen

Epitope: Second cytoplasmic domain
KLH-conjugated linear peptide corresponding to the second cytoplasmic domain of rat Sodium Pump Subunit alpha-2.

Zastosowanie

Detect Sodium Pump Subunit alpha-2 using this Anti-Sodium Pump Subunit alpha-2 Antibody validated for use in Western Blotting,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in) and Immunoprecipitation.
Immunohistochemistry Analysis (IHC): A representative lot detected Sodium Pump Subunit alpha-2 in human (1:1,000) and rat (1:250) cerebellum tissue sections.

Immunoprecipitation Analysis (IP): 10 ug from a representative lot immunoprecipitated Sodium Pump Subunit alpha-2 in 500 µg of rat brain tissue lysate.
